What “Time” Actually Looks Like
We break the 90-day project into four phases. Below is a minute-by-minute ledger taken from Elgon Cafe (1,100 staff) and RV Dairy (320 staff).
PHASE A – DIAGNOSIS (Week 0)
| Task | Who | Minutes | Format |
|---|---|---|---|
| Scope call | MD + HR | 30 | Phone |
| Diagnosis workshop | Exec team (6 ppl) | 105 | On-site 08:00-09:45 |
| Floor walk | Ops Dir | 30 | Plant tour |
| Data drop | HR officer | 15 | Email CSV export |
| TOTAL EXEC TIME | 180 (3 hrs) |
PHASE B – DESIGN (Week 1)
| Task | Who | Minutes |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Review 1-page plan | MD | 45 | PDF, comments |
| Quick approve | WhatsApp voice | 5 | |
| TOTAL EXEC TIME | 50 |
PHASE C – PILOT (Week 2-6)
| Weekly action | Who | Minutes/week |
|---|---|---|
| Reply to 3 voice notes | MD | 6 |
| Sign off dashboard screenshot | Ops Dir | 12 |
| 15-min huddle with managers | Whole team | 15 |
| WEEKLY AVERAGE | 27 | |
| Over 5 weeks = 135 min ≈ 2 hrs 15 min |
PHASE D – LOCK-IN (Week 7-12)
| Task | Who | Minutes |
|---|---|---|
| Final review meeting | Exec | 60 |
| Board slide approval | MD | 30 |
| SOP sign-off | HR | 30 |
| TOTAL EXEC TIME | 120 (2 hrs) |
GRAND TOTAL: 180 + 50 + 135 + 120 = 485 min = 8 hrs 5 min
Even if we add a 20 % buffer for chit-chat, you remain under 10 hours across three months – or 27 minutes a week.

Micro-Meeting Rules We Follow
- 9 AM cap – never touch your revenue hours.
- 15 min default – phone timer visible.
- Agenda sent 24 hrs prior – 3 bullets max.
- One decision only – if we need two, we book a second slot.
